Today I’m going to be showing off some great inspirational quotes I have recently added to my master bedroom.

While browsing Pinterest one day, I found these two inspirational quotes. I immediately thought they would be great in our master bedroom. I imagined looking at them when I woke up each morning and getting energized for the day, rather than dreading all the whining that comes with getting the kids ready for school and changing diapers.

The first quote is by Gordon B. Hinckley (president/prophet to the LDS church from 1995-2008), and the second quote is by his wife, Marjorie Pay Hinckley. I also thought it was fitting that quotes from a husband and wife should be in our master bedroom.

I printed out the quotes onto some white card stock and stuck them in a frame I already had.

I plan to spray paint the black frame oil rubbed bronze so it matches our other frames, lamps and dresser knobs better. Just waiting for spring and warmer weather so I can spray paint outside. Until then, I don’t think it looks too bad.

I love waking up and reading these quotes. What a great way to start my day, live in the moment, and enjoy life.
